Adeseye Senfuye's Church Begins Special Empowerment For Ogun Youths by lalekanyinusa(m): 8:42am On Jul 01, 2018
A special empowerment of the Nigerian youth aimed at tackling the worrisome unemployment of the mass of the Nigerian youth has begun.

The project conceptualized and sponsored by the General Overseer of Treasure House of God, Abeokuta, Ogun State , Adeseye Senfuye, whose styles as the Set man will run from Saturday June 30 to Saturday July 21, 2018.

According to the Media Consultant to the Set Man of the church, Adeniyi Adeloye the event is holding at the church premises at 177 Quarry Road, Opposite Peace Foundation International College, Agbeloba, Abeokuta,Ogun state, adding that participants have been drawn from far and near throughout the Nigerian nation.

He said the decision to hold the empowerment project was borne of Pastor Adeseye Senfuye's conviction that empowerment of the youth was a veritable way of building a new Nigeria in line with the vision of the federal Government which has, since coming into power, has been working so conscientiously and assiduously.

He disclosed that the project would definitely cough out a lot of financial commitment from the coffers of the sponsor, but he was willing and ready to invest hugely in the youth because, according to him, the youth are indispensable factors in the pursuit of a treasured Nigeria.

I keep saying it that most wealthy churches (including the Catholic Church) should STOP building churches! The expansion is enough!!! Let them focus on youth empowerment. And as a matter of fact, it's a WIN-WIN. Imagine a church having a sort of training centre for skill acquisition and they train youths on computer computer related courses (cos the world has gone digital) and some some other programmes like tailoring, makeup artist and gele tying, hairdressing, barbing, catering and other RELEVANT skills, and after their training, you already have jobs for them i.e, shops have already been equipped for them to practice their skills. And who's the owner of these shops? The church!!!! They can decide to pay them lesser salaries for a year (to recover what has been invested in them), and after that year, they pay them their full salaries. Such agreement will be clearly stated in the application form and signed by a reputable Referee. The profit from these shops goes to the church, and they can decide to do more youth investment.

By the way, these churches needn't start with ALL those skills I've mentioned above, but computer should be constant.

But instead of these wealthy churches to carryout such investments on youths, you'll see them organising useless seminars on one rubbish or the other: How to safe money, how to profit from online business. And the even more useless ones: How to make beads, soap making, bread making, how to make hand wash, how to make puff puff... you name it!

Hopefully, they'll see that the church can effectively help the community through such programmes.
